What it meant

βαρβᾰρό-φωνος · barbaro-phōnos — LSJ

speaking a foreign tongue

speaking a foreign tongue, Κᾶρες Il. 2.867; of the Persians, Orac. ap. Hdt. 8.20, 9.43.

II speaking bad Greek

speaking bad Greek, Str. 14.2.28.
